Abstract
A method to perform an on demand refresh operation of a memory sub-system is disclosed. The method includes sending an initial translation map to a host system coupled to a memory component, receiving, from the host system, a modified translation map, and performing, by a processing device, a refresh operation of the memory component using the modified translation map.
